On April 24, 2026, GRI Bio Inc. (GRI) trades at a current price of $2.31, marking a 3.14% decline from the prior session close. This analysis evaluates recent price action for GRI, key technical support and resistance levels, broader sector context, and potential near-term scenarios for the stock. No recent earnings data is available for GRI at the time of writing, so technical factors and broader market sentiment are the primary drivers of current price action.
